Group Buy II

I have had an inquiry about the deep oil pan. So I am going to see if I can get enough interest to do a group buy. I need to get a minimum of three (3), which will be a small group buy.

This is a pricey mod. Cost is $1100. This includes:

1. Oil Pan
2. Oil sump pick-up tube spacer.
3. Stainless bolts, washers & lockwashers.
4. Toyota gaskets (2) for the oil pick up tube.
5. Toyota FIPG
6. Four (4) BMW trap doors.
7. A magnetic drain plug (gold plug).


Pan is machined from a single block of 6061-T6 aluminum with the baffles heli-arced into place. If you use a large oil filter, capacity is 7 1/2 quarts. You will probably loose 1/4 quart if you use a regular oil filter.

Installation is pretty easy. I have done a write up.
